Description

A balance sheet is an accounting tool used to summarize the financial status of a business or other entity. It generally lists assets on one side and liabilities on the other, and both sides are always in balance. Assets and liabilities are divided into short- and long-term obligations including cash accounts such as checking, money market, or government securities. At any given time, assets must equal liabilities plus owners equity. An asset is anything the business owns that has monetary value. Liabilities are the claims of creditors against the assets of the business. A balance sheet is usually prepared each month, quarter of a year, annually, or upon sale of the business, in order to show the overall condition of the company.

A balance sheet is a financial "snapshot" of your business at a given date in time. It includes your assets and liabilities and tells you your business's net worth. The New Hampshire Quarterly Balance Sheet is a financial statement that provides a detailed snapshot of an organization's financial position at the end of each quarter. It is an essential tool for businesses and investors to assess the financial health and stability of a company operating within the state of New Hampshire. This balance sheet includes several key components that present the organization's assets, liabilities, and shareholders' equity. The assets section encompasses both current and non-current assets, such as cash, accounts receivable, inventory, property, and equipment. Liabilities encompass short-term and long-term obligations, including accounts payable, accrued expenses, loans, and mortgages. Shareholders' equity represents the residual interest of the organization's owners after deducting liabilities.
